DES MOINES, Iowa - An Omaha, Neb. woman was traveling through Council Bluffs when she decided to pick up one of the Iowa Lottery's new "Tropical Treasures" instant-scratch tickets and ended up winning the top prize.
Janice 'Jaymie' Burns, 35, said she picked up a ticket while she was having her tire changed, but she never expected to win the $30,000 top prize.
"It was the first one I scratched off. I was thinking, 'Gosh it would be nice to win that. All of a sudden I saw the third treasure chest and I had to have my brother down and double check it for me," she said.
Burns said her brother, Chad Flynn, didn't believe her at first, but once he saw the ticket he changed his mind very quickly. Burns also shared the news about her win with her grandpa.
"He said he just wants me to appreciate it, which is what everyone has been saying," she said.
Burns, an account manager for GEM Financial, claimed her prize Friday at the Iowa Lottery's regional office in Council Bluffs, the same day she purchased the ticket. She purchased her winning ticket at Darrah's, 3607 Ninth Ave. in Council Bluffs.
Burns plans to use some of her winnings to pay bills.
